Archive & Records Officer
is responsible for the secure custody, organization, control, and auditing of all original student documents at Batterjee Medical College.
This role ensures
confidentiality, accuracy, traceability, and regulatory compliance
in managing physical archives, with strict access control and documented accountability for every original record.
Key Responsibilities
1. Custody & Document Control
-
Act as the official custodian of all original student documents, including:
-
High school certificates
-
Academic transcripts
-
Result cards
-
Graduation certificates
-
Scholarship contracts
-
Promissory notes
-
Financial and legal undertakings
-
Ensure secure storage, preservation, and protection of all records
-
Maintain a zero-tolerance approach to document loss, damage, or unauthorized handling
2. Archive Organization & Filing System
-
Establish and maintain structured filing and numbering systems
-
Arrange documents based on:
-
Student ID
-
Program
-
Intake
-
Academic year
-
Label and index all cabinets and files for audit readiness
-
Ensure documents are easily retrievable without compromising confidentiality
3. Access Control & Authorization
-
Enforce strict access control to the archive room
-
Release original documents only upon approved written request
-
Maintain a document tracking register including:
-
Document name
-
Student ID
-
Date & time
-
Purpose
-
Authorized recipient signature
-
Ensure full accountability for every document movement
4. Audit & Compliance
-
Conduct periodic (semester/annual) physical audits
-
Reconcile physical documents with system records
-
Prepare audit reports covering:
-
Document availability
-
Completeness
-
Storage condition
-
Compliance gaps
-
Escalate discrepancies and risks immediately
5. Documentation & Tracking
-
Maintain updated logs for:
-
Stored documents
-
Retrieved documents
-
Returned documents
-
Ensure full traceability of all document movements
-
Support internal and external audits
6. Confidentiality & Compliance
-
Maintain strict confidentiality of all records
-
Ensure compliance with:
-
BMC policies and procedures
-
NCAAA requirements
-
Ministry of Education regulations
-
Data protection standards
-
Handle sensitive and legal documents with high ethical standards
Authority & Accountability
-
Full custodial responsibility for all original student documents
-
Accountable for document accuracy, safety, and integrity
-
Authorized to deny access to unauthorized individuals
-
Required to escalate any risks or violations immediately
